With vehicles ferrying students packed like sardines and instances of drunk driving on the rise, working parents often find themselves on edge, struggling with unreliable transport services for their children.

To address this, a Bengaluru-based start-up is offering MetroRide Kids, an app-based service that promises to offer safe and reliable transport for children (5-16 years) to schools, coaching centres, and after-school activities.

The startup, which recently launched its services in Hyderabad, plans to expand to its home city. As part of this, it will collaborate with parents, hire trained drivers, equip vehicles with CCTV cameras and GPS tracking devices, and deploy electric vehicles for its operations.
